SIDEWARD

(adverb, adj.)

Definitions

There are 2 meanings of the word Sideward.

Sideward - as an adverb

Toward one side

Example: "Turn the figure sideward"

Synonyms (Exact Relations)
sidewards14

Sideward - as an adjective

Toward a side.
